多边形是几何学中非常基础且重要的概念,其面积计算在数学、工程学、计算机图形学等领域都有着广泛的应用。本文将深入探讨多边形面积计算的数学框架,并提供一些实用的技巧。
一、多边形面积计算的基本原理
多边形面积的计算方法多种多样,但大多数方法都基于以下基本原理:
- 分割法:将多边形分割成若干个简单的几何图形(如三角形、矩形等),然后分别计算这些图形的面积,最后将它们相加得到多边形的总面积。
- 坐标法:利用多边形顶点的坐标,通过数学公式直接计算面积。
1.1 分割法
分割法适用于任意多边形,以下是一个常见的分割方法:
- 将多边形分割成若干个三角形。
- 计算每个三角形的面积。
- 将所有三角形的面积相加。
1.2 坐标法
坐标法适用于凸多边形,以下是一个常用的坐标法:
- 利用多边形顶点的坐标,通过以下公式计算面积:
[ \text{面积} = \frac{1}{2} \left| \sum_{i=1}^{n-1} (xi y{i+1} - yi x{i+1}) + (x_n y_1 - y_n x_1) \right| ]
其中,( (x_1, y_1), (x_2, y_2), \ldots, (x_n, y_n) ) 是多边形的顶点坐标。
二、多边形面积计算的实用技巧
在实际应用中,以下技巧可以帮助我们更高效地计算多边形面积:
- 利用计算机软件:许多计算机软件(如MATLAB、Python等)都提供了多边形面积计算函数,可以方便地实现面积计算。
- 图形化表示:在计算面积时,将多边形图形化表示可以帮助我们更好地理解问题,并找到合适的计算方法。
- 近似计算:对于一些不规则的多边形,可以使用近似计算方法来快速得到面积值。
三、案例分析
以下是一个具体的案例分析:
假设我们有一个凸多边形,其顶点坐标为 ( (1, 2), (3, 4), (5, 6), (7, 8) ),我们需要计算该多边形的面积。
- 使用坐标法计算:
[ \text{面积} = \frac{1}{2} \left| (1 \times 4 - 2 \times 3) + (3 \times 6 - 4 \times 5) + (5 \times 8 - 6 \times 7) + (7 \times 2 - 8 \times 1) \right| ] [ \text{面积} = \frac{1}{2} \left| 2 + 6 + 14 + 6 \right| ] [ \text{面积} = \frac{1}{2} \times 28 ] [ \text{面积} = 14 ]
- 使用MATLAB代码计算:
% 定义多边形顶点坐标
vertices = [1, 2; 3, 4; 5, 6; 7, 8];
% 计算面积
area = 0.5 * abs(sum(vertices(:,1) .* (vertices(:,2) - [vertices(:,2); vertices(:,1)])));
disp(area);
运行上述代码,可以得到多边形的面积为14。
四、总结
本文详细介绍了多边形面积计算的数学框架和实用技巧。通过学习这些知识,我们可以更好地理解和应用多边形面积计算,解决实际问题。在实际应用中,我们可以根据具体情况选择合适的计算方法,以提高计算效率和准确性。
